WATERMAN PENS


Waterman is a luxury pen manufacturer based in France.

They specialize in a selection of high-quality pens, with a particular focus on fountain pens.

Legend has it that in 1884's Lewis Edson Waterman invented a new fountain pen technology after losing a big sale with a client due to a leaky fountain pen.

A few years later Waterman Pens received the gold medal of Excellence at the “Exposition Universelle” in Paris.

This famed level of design and manufacturing continues to the current day.

This model first appeared in 1971's as a pen made specifically for the student market, and as one might expect in a pen aimed at youth, it has changed its looks substantially.  

The newer version of the Graduate is a quite low-end, popular-market pen, apparently made only for sale in Europe, as it doesn’t appear to have ever been marketed in North America (a situation which it shared with other, even lower-end pens offered by the company). 

 Almost all one ever sees of this model is the chrome version shown below, although there was also a Pro Graduate which might very easily be mistaken for the Apostrophe by dint of having a lacquer finish.  

The difference between Pro Graduate and Apostrophe lies in the former’s lack of trim, since like its unprofessional brother it has no derby nor cap band. 

 To add to the confusion, there is a sort of intermediate model called the Allure, which has the band of the Apostrophe but the chrome plating and extremely simple cap jewel of the Graduate. Update:  Stumbling upon a 2007 European price list, I find that the Allure was actually a lower priced pen than the Graduate; live and learn.

Perfomance is about what one expects in a low-priced pen, which is to say rather sub-par for almost any self-respecting Waterman.  There are some fine examples, but if one comes your way it would be right to expect flow issues and a certain amount of scratchy discomfort from waving the point around one the page.

Production Run: First sort c.1970's to c.1980's; this is very approximate, and based upon looks and logos rather than firm sources.  

The second ran from c. 1995's to c. 2010's, and may still be covertly in production for sale only in France, as they seem to be available there.


Foutain pen



Size: 13.6 cm long capped, 15.6 cm posted, 12.4 cm uncapped.


Point: Steel.


Body: Chrome.


  In the form of the Pro Graduate there were more interesting finishes.


Filler: Cartridge, capacity approx. 0.6 ml or 1.4 ml (international pattern).
